As for the BMP-3 i expect that it can fire it's main gun while in water. |
I dont expect amphibious vehicles to go charging toward the shore with guns blazing in the face of enemy fire although thats what the USMC is trained to do. From what I have read almost all of the most current and next gen amphibious APC's/IFV's can fire while in the water and most have stabilized guns allowing them to do it accurately. The new Chinese IFV is comparable in peformance to the new USMC Expeditionary Fighting Vehicle and currently carries same turret as the BMP-3 and it can fire its 100mm low pressure gun while in the water and moving. |
